- Stand-up display, in particular stand-up display figure (10), made of paper, cardboard, paperboard or the like, consisting of at least one first blank (13) and at least one second blank (14, 39), wherein the first blank (13) can be folded to form a base element (11) having two transverse sides (27), two longitudinal sides (15), a standing side (18) and a receiving side (28) and the second blank (14, 39) as plug-in element (12) can be plugged onto the base element (11) to stabilize the base element (11), wherein the plug-in element (12) has three tabs (33, 34, 35), namely two outer tabs (33, 35) and one middle tab (34), between which recesses (36, 37) are formed, wherein the outer tabs (33, 35) have latching elements (38) corresponding to openings (23) in outer walls (17) of the base element (11), and wherein the latching elements (38) are in the form of webs in order to form a fixed connection between the base element (11) and the plug-in element (12), and the tabs (33, 34, 35) and the recesses (36, 37) are formed such that the plug-in element (12) can be plugged into the receiving side (28) of the base element (11), and characterized in that the base element (11) is in the form of a truncated pyramid.
- Stand-up display according to Claim 1, characterized in that the face, in particular the projected face, of the standing side (18) is larger than the face, in particular the projected face, of the receiving side (28).
- Stand-up display according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the first blank (13) is provided such that, after the folding to form the base element (11), the transverse sides (27) are each composed of an inner wall (16) and the outer wall (17), which in particular can be folded one on top of the other almost congruently, preferably the outer wall (17) and inner wall (16) respectively protrude beyond the inner wall (16) and outer wall (17) in the region of the receiving side (28).
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the inner walls (16) and the outer walls (17) of the first blank (13) each have a recess (20, 21) that is open on one side and, when the walls (16, 17) are being folded to form the base element (11), the recesses (20, 21) can be joined one on top of the other with the open side in the direction of the receiving side (28).
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the outer walls (17) each have at least one opening (23), which openings are of similar form and are positioned uniformly on the outer walls (17), preferably are of circular, oval or rectangular form.
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that an in particular slot-like aperture (24) is assigned to the standing side (18) and preferably extends to the longitudinal sides (15) or transverse sides (27) to form a receptacle in the bottom region of the base element (11).
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the plug-in element (12) is formed as a plate-like silhouette having a front and a rear side, wherein the silhouette may be of any desired form.
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the second blank (14, 39) forming the plug-in element (12) can be folded to form the desired silhouette, in particular can be folded together to improve the stability in itself.
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the recesses (36, 37) of the plug-in element (12) and the recesses (20, 21) of the inner and of the outer walls (16, 17) that are open on one side can be pushed one into the other.
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the outer tabs (33, 35) have latching elements (38) that are aligned with respect to the middle tab (34) and correspond to the openings (23) in the outer walls (17) of the base element (11).
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the latching elements (38) are of barb-like form in order to form a fixed, in particular detachable, connection between the base element (11) and the silhouette.
- Stand-up display according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the blanks (13, 14, 39) can be punched out or detached out of a piece of paper, paperboard, cardboard or the like and the folding edges (19) are pre-folded or perforated.
